Joseph Rosendo’s Travelscope
San Miguel de Allende, Celebrating in the Heart of Mexico
Season 6
Episode 609
Joseph makes his way to San Miguel de Allende, Mexico for the annual Fiesta de San Miguel, a celebration in honor of its patron saint. During his stay he soaks in the mystical Mayan Baths, steams with a shaman in a sweat lodge, sails in a hot air balloon and meets Chef Felipe of the Casa de Sierra Nevada, one of the town’s top chefs, to pick up the fixings for his one-on-one cooking class.
